State Super appoints new CIO

24 January 2019
| By Hannah |
image
image
expand image

State Super has announced institutional investments veteran, Gary Gabriel, as its new chief investment officer, effective from early next month.

Gabriel would bring over 20 years’ experience to the role, most recently as general manager, portfolio strategy and risk at HESTA.

State Super chief executive, John Livanas, welcomed Gabriel’s track record in managing superannuation investment portfolios through market cycles, as well as his understanding of actuarial and defined benefit issues.
